Doon Firefighters Extinguish Cornstalk Pile Fire

Doon, Iowa — About 25 round-bales worth of ground cornstalks were destroyed in a fire on Tuesday, April 5, 2022, near Doon.

According to Doon Fire Chief Blake Van Bemmel, at about 11:15 a.m., the Doon Fire Department was called to the report of cornstalks on fire near a machine shed at 3198 260th Street, four miles east of the south side of Doon.

The chief says the fire department saw a pile of ground-up cornstalks on fire as they approached the scene. He says they used water and spread out the stalks to fight the fire.

Van Bemmel says no injuries were reported.

The fire department was assisted by the Alvord Fire Department. Van Bemmel tells us they brought water to the scene.

He says the cause of the fire is undetermined.

He says the firefighters who responded were on the scene for about two hours.
